We have some info on the great lineup of talks/lectures/presentations that will be given this year:


TALKS GIVEN BY INVITED SPEAKERS:

There are four talks throughout the day and will be held at the Firehouse. A link to the schedule is available on the burningamp.org Home page:
The official BurningAmp web site

Nelson Pass will be talking about his new amplifiers which diyAudio will sell as kits and should have them to demo alongf with tons of other cool stuff including the awesome SAL speakers in his audition rooms

Siegfried Linkwitz will give a presentation on audio perception, and demo his acclaimed LX series open baffle speakers in his audition room.

Demian Martin will demonstrate the only existing sample in the U.S. of a new precision measurement interface for computers which has unheard of performance per dollar and also a device designed by Jan Didden that automatically sets the input voltage to your computer interface to 1 volt to get the best measurements and not blow it up! He will have them on display at a table in the Firehouse and may do some tests of amps for people to demonstrate them

Wayne Colburn from Pass Labs will be about his new headphone amp design and the PCB’s he can supply for them and how he approaches some common circuit design issues. He will also have a table in the Firehouse where you can listen to it. Bring your own headphones for the most meaningful experience!

The talks are throughout the day and will be held at the Firehouse.
